Localization

Localization Comment Organism GeneOntology No. Textmining
actin cytoskeleton CsmA tagged with 9*HA epitopes is localized near actin structures at the hyphal tips and septation sites. Its myosin motor-like domain is able to bind to actin. Interaction between the myosin motor-like domain and actin is not only necessary for the proper localization of CsmA, but also for CsmA function Aspergillus nidulans 15629
